Prioritise Mobile Performance for Restaurant Discovery

The majority of restaurant searches happen on mobile - often in the moment, on the street, while deciding between nearby options. A squarespace food website that looks great on desktop but buries the menu and booking options on a smartphone loses its most valuable, highest-intent visitors. Basil and Tantillo are both built with mobile-first booking journeys at their core. For any template, test the mobile experience before launch: can a first-time visitor find your menu, check your hours, and book a table within 30 seconds? That's the minimum standard for squarespace restaurant websites in a mobile-first discovery environment.

Can I add online reservations to a Squarespace food website template?

Yes. All squarespace food website templates support online booking integration. Squarespace's native scheduling tool handles table reservations with customisable time slots, party size settings, and confirmation emails. Third-party systems like OpenTable, Resy, Tock, and SevenRooms can be embedded via a code block or integration. Adding Squarespace Scheduling starts at approximately $16/month as an add-on to any plan. Choose your booking integration before finalising your template - CTA placement is a design decision, not an afterthought.

How do I add a menu to a Squarespace restaurant website?

Squarespace offers a dedicated Menu block on Business and Commerce plans that creates structured menus with sections, items, descriptions, and prices - no PDF required. Alternatively, build menu pages using text and image blocks for full design control, or link to a hosted PDF. For restaurants updating menus frequently, the Menu block is the most practical option since it edits directly without a page redesign. All five food website templates support menu integration - Basil and Tantillo are specifically designed with menu prominence as a layout priority.

What Squarespace plan do I need for a restaurant website?

The Squarespace Basic plan at $16/month (billed annually) supports a fully functional squarespace food website including custom domain, SSL, unlimited pages, and all template features. For selling gift vouchers, merchandise, or taking online orders, the Commerce Basic plan at $23/month adds full e-commerce functionality. Squarespace Scheduling adds on at approximately $16/month. Most squarespace restaurant websites run effectively on the Basic plan with a scheduling add-on - bringing total monthly cost to under $35.

Can I use a Squarespace food template for a food delivery or ordering website?

Yes. Squarespace's Commerce plans support online ordering with product pages, a shopping cart, and payment processing. For dedicated ordering systems with kitchen ticket integration, third-party platforms like Square, Toast, or ChowNow can be embedded or linked from any Squarespace page. Basil and Tantillo are particularly well suited to food ordering use cases thanks to their clear navigation and prominent CTA placement. For delivery-focused food businesses, prioritise a flawless mobile experience - the majority of food orders are placed on smartphones.

Can I switch Squarespace food templates after my site is built?

Yes. On Squarespace 7.1, you can switch templates at any time without losing content - pages, blog posts, products, and media all migrate cleanly. The layout and visual presentation will change, but your content is preserved. The practical consideration is that photography styled for one template's proportions may need adjusting for another's - a square hero that worked in Stanton may need recropping for Troutman's widescreen slideshow. Always do a thorough page review after switching and test the mobile experience before relaunching.

What pages should a restaurant website include?

A well-structured squarespace food website should include: a homepage that communicates concept, atmosphere, and booking path immediately; a menu page with your current food and drink offering; a reservations page with live scheduling; an about page with your story and chef profile; a contact page with address, hours, phone, and map embed; and a private dining or events page if relevant. Restaurants investing in local SEO should add location-specific content and a press page if you've received notable coverage. All five templates reviewed here support this full page architecture within a standard Squarespace subscription.
